Choosing Accessories to Pair with Rivelle Clothing
When selecting accessories to match Rivelle clothing, consider the overall aesthetic of your outfit. Classic pieces, such as statement jewelry or elegant handbags, can enhance the sophistication of a Rivelle dress or blouse. Opt for minimalist designs when wearing bold patterns to strike a balance.
Additionally, layering can be a great way to add depth to your look. A structured blazer can transform a casual outfit into something more formal, while a chic scarf can add a touch of personality. The key is to maintain cohesion between the clothing and accessories—choose colors and styles that complement rather than clash.
Common Mistakes in Fashion Styling
One common mistake in fashion styling is over-accessorizing. While accessories can enhance an outfit, piling on too many can lead to a cluttered appearance. Stick to a few statement pieces that draw attention without overwhelming the overall look.
Another pitfall is neglecting the fit of accessories. For instance, wearing oversized bags with fitted attire can disrupt the desired proportions. Ensuring that accessories align harmoniously with clothing fit can make a significant difference in the overall visual appeal.
